#941204 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#941204 is composed of 58% red, 7.1%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.8% magenta, 97.3%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 5.8 degrees, a saturation of 94.7% and a lightness of 29.8%. #941204 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2408 with #290000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#941204 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#941204 has RGB values of R:148, G:18,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.97,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9703940.
